CITY OF COMMERCE, Calif., Nov. 9, 2011 /PRNewswire/ -- 99 Cents Only Stores® (NYSE: NDN) (the "Company") announced its financial results for the second quarter ended October 1, 2011.

Highlights for the second quarter of fiscal 2012 compared to the second quarter of fiscal 2011:

  • Retail sales for the Company's consolidated operations increased by 9.0% to $352.2 million and same-store sales increased 6.7%
  • Consolidated gross margin decreased by 60 basis points to 40.2% of sales
    • Product cost increased by 70 basis points to 57.4%
    • Shrinkage was lower by 20 basis points at 2.2%
    • Other items in cost of sales increased by 10 basis points to 0.3%
  • Consolidated operating expenses decreased by 100 basis points to 31.5% of sales
    • Retail operating costs decreased 140 basis points to 22.4%
    • Distribution and transportation costs decreased 20 basis points to 4.8%
    • Corporate G&A costs increased 30 basis points to 3.6%
    • Other operating expenses increased 30 basis points to 0.7% which included a negative impact of $1.1 million or 30 basis points of professional fees related to the going private transaction
  • Consolidated Income Before Taxes increased to $24.4 million, or 6.7% of revenues, from $20.8 million, or 6.2% of revenues, in the prior year
  • Consolidated net income increased by $2.2 million to $15.1 million or $0.21 per diluted share, versus $12.9 million in the prior year, or $0.18 per diluted share

CONSOLIDATED RESULTS

Net consolidated sales for the second quarter of fiscal 2012 were $363.0 million, an 8.8% increase compared to net sales of $333.6 million for the second quarter of fiscal 2011.  Retail sales for the Company's consolidated operations increased by 9.0% to $352.2 million. Same-store sales calculated on a comparable 13-week period increased 6.7%.

Consolidated gross profit for the second quarter of fiscal 2012 was $145.8 million, compared to $136.1 million for the second quarter of the prior fiscal year.  The Company's consolidated gross profit margin was 40.2% for the second quarter of fiscal 2012 versus 40.8% for the second quarter of the prior fiscal year. The decrease in gross profit margin was primarily due to an increase in cost of products sold to 57.4% of net sales in the second quarter of fiscal 2012 from 56.7% of net sales in the second quarter of fiscal 2011 that was primarily attributable to merchandise price increases and a shift in product mix. Freight costs also increased 20 basis points in the second quarter of fiscal 2012. These unfavorable variances were offset by decreases in shrinkage to 2.2% of net sales in the second quarter of fiscal 2012 from 2.4% of net sales in the second quarter of fiscal 2011, and other less significant items included in cost of sales.

Operating expenses were $114.4 million, or 31.5% of consolidated sales, for the fiscal 2012 second quarter versus $108.3 million, or 32.5% of sales, for the second quarter of the prior fiscal year.  The Company's improved operating expense ratio is primarily due to lower payroll-related expenses as a result of improvement in store labor productivity, which was partially offset by an increase in legal accruals of approximately $1.8 million for estimated future payments for settlement of litigation and professional fees of approximately $1.1 million pertaining to the going private transaction and the related process.

Consolidated operating income for the second quarter of fiscal 2012 was $24.4 million, compared to $20.7 million for the second quarter of fiscal 2011.  Operating income as a percentage of net sales was 6.7% in fiscal 2012 compared to 6.2% in fiscal 2011.

Net income for the second quarter of fiscal 2012 increased to $15.1 million, or $0.21 per diluted share, compared to net income of $12.9 million, or $0.18 per diluted share, for the second quarter of fiscal 2011.

OUTLOOK

The Company believes that revenue growth in the remainder of fiscal 2012 will primarily result from increases in same-store sales, the full-year effect of stores opened since last year, and new store openings. For fiscal 2012, as previously announced, the Company has raised its same-store-sales percentage increase expectations for the full year to mid-single digits and plans to open 12 stores in the second half of the year.  Of these 12 new stores, the Company has already opened one store in the third quarter and plans to open two more stores in the third quarter and approximately nine stores in the fourth quarter of fiscal 2012.  The majority of these new store openings in fiscal 2012 will be in California. The Company plans to accelerate its store growth rate to approximately 10% in fiscal 2013, with the majority of new stores expected to be in California.

CASH AND LIQUIDITY

As of the end of the second quarter of fiscal 2012, the Company held $222.7 million in cash and short and long-term marketable securities, and had no debt.  The Company's inventories at the end of the second quarter of fiscal 2012 were $233.2 million versus $197.0 million at the end of second quarter of fiscal 2011. The increase in inventories was primarily due to early receipts of seasonal items, opportunistic buys and to drive higher seasonal sales.

Founded in 1982, 99 Cents Only Stores® operates 289 extreme value retail stores with 214 in California, 35 in Texas, 27 in Arizona and 13 in Nevada. The Company's next store grand opening is Thursday November 10th in Sugar Land, Texas. 99 Cents Only Stores® emphasizes quality name-brand consumables, priced at an excellent value, in convenient, attractively merchandised stores. Over half of the Company's sales come from food and beverages, including produce, dairy, deli and frozen foods, along with organic and gourmet foods.
